I once read that Catherine Zeta Jones has a "bad boy clause" with Michael Douglas. He was known to have sexual proclivities that helped end his first marriage. That he had a real bad boy streak during his
Basic Instinct and
Fatal Attraction days that weren't all make believe. Douglas helped popularize the term, "sexual addiction."

(Now, it's probably be called being Tiger Woods.

) Zeta Jones knew full well about his reputation. She actually helped tone down his reputation by being with him.
Allegedly, Zeta Jones gets another few million if they divorce, on top of what was agreed upon, if he's been proven to have been cheating. And for every 3 years they've been married, the payout goes up percentage-wise according to how long they've been married.
